Frenchmen voted Sunday to send former Premier George Pompidou and interim President Alain Poher into a runoff presidential election June 15 in which Communist votes could decide which of the two middle-of-the-road candidates would replace Charles de Gaulle. Running virtually as strongly as de Gaulle did in the first round of the 1965 presidential balloting, Pompidou polled near 45 percent of the votes.
